Honeymoon Itinerary in Goa

Thursday, September 21: Arrival in Goa

Begin your romantic honeymoon in Goa by arriving in this coastal paradise. Check into your chosen hotel or resort and take some time to relax and settle in. In the morning, you can enjoy a leisurely stroll along the beautiful beaches of North Goa like Calangute or Baga, feeling the soft sand beneath your feet. In the afternoon, head to Fort Aguada to explore the historic fort and enjoy breathtaking views of the Arabian Sea. As the evening sets in, savor a candlelit dinner at a beachfront restaurant, immersing yourselves in the serene coastal ambiance.

  • Beach Time in North Goa: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Fort Aguada: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Romantic Dinner by the Beach: Estimated cost ₹2,000-₹4,000, 2-3 hours
Friday, September 22: South Goa Exploration

Embark on a journey to discover the charms of South Goa. Start your morning with a visit to the magnificent Basilica of Bom Jesus,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that houses the mortal remains of St. Francis Xavier. In the afternoon, explore the beautiful beaches of South Goa like Palolem or Varca, where you can relax under the swaying palm trees. As the sun begins to set, take a romantic sunset cruise along the Mandovi River, enjoying the scenic beauty and serenity.

  •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Beach Time in South Goa: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Sunset Cruise on Mandovi River: Estimated cost ₹2,000-₹3,000, 2-3 hours
Saturday, September 23: Dudhsagar Waterfalls and Spice Plantation

Embark on an adventure to the majestic Dudhsagar Waterfalls, one of Goa's most mesmerizing natural wonders. In the morning, take a scenic drive to the falls and witness the milky white cascade amidst lush greenery. After enjoying the natural beauty, head to a nearby spice plantation to learn about Goa's aromatic spices and indulge in a traditional Goan lunch. In the afternoon, you can relax and enjoy the serene surroundings of the plantation. In the evening, return to your hotel and spend quality time together.

  • Dudhsagar Waterfalls Trip: Estimated cost ₹4,000-₹6,000, 6-8 hours
  • Spice Plantation Visit: Estimated cost ₹1,500-₹2,500, 2-3 hours
Sunday, September 24: Old Goa Heritage Tour

Delve into the rich history and heritage of Goa with a visit to Old Goa, the former capital of the Portuguese Indies. Start your morning with a visit to the stunning Se Cathedral, one of the largest churches in Asia. Afterward, explore the nearby Church of St. Francis of Assisi and the Basilica of Bom Jesus. In the afternoon, stroll through the quaint streets and admire the well-preserved Portuguese architecture. As the day comes to an end, enjoy a romantic dinner at a Portuguese-inspired restaurant, savoring the flavors of Goan cuisine.

  • Se Cathedral: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Church of St. Francis of Assisi: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Exploring Old Goa: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Romantic Dinner at a Portuguese-inspired Restaurant: Estimated cost ₹2,500-₹4,000, 2-3 hours
Monday, September 25: Beach Bliss and Sunset Cruise

Indulge in the sun, sand, and sea on your final day in Goa. Spend the morning relaxing on the pristine beaches of Goa, such as Vagator or Morjim, and soak up the coastal beauty. In the afternoon, you can try thrilling watersports like parasailing or jet skiing, creating unforgettable memories together. As the evening approaches, board a sunset cruise along the Arabian Sea, witnessing the mesmerizing colors painting the sky. End your honeymoon on a blissful note, reminiscing about the magical moments you've shared in Goa.

  • Beach Time: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Watersports Activities: Estimated cost ₹2,000-₹5,000, 2-3 hours
  • Sunset Cruise: Estimated cost ₹2,000-₹3,000, 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While Goa is known for its popular attractions, there are also hidden gems and local favorites worth exploring during your honeymoon. Visit the peaceful and secluded Butterfly Beach in South Goa, where you can witness dolphins playing in the crystal-clear waters. Take a romantic walk along the Chapora Fort, famous for its panoramic views of the coastline and sunset. For a unique cultural experience, attend a live music performance at a local jazz club, immersing yourselves in the soulful tunes of Goa's talented musicians.
